Job Summary

This role involves supporting the Chair of Molecular Genetics at the University of Konstanz in an internationally competitive laboratory setting. As a Laboratory Technical Assistant, you will perform a variety of biochemical and molecular biology tasks, including recombinant protein purification, PCR-based mutagenesis, and the creation of stable cell lines. Beyond wet lab work, you will handle administrative duties such as ordering supplies, documenting data, and providing technical guidance to students. This position offers a unique opportunity to work within a prestigious 'University of Excellence' located in a scenic region. The role is initially part-time (90%) with a planned increase to full-time (100%) by January 2027. It is particularly attractive for both experienced professionals and career starters who value an interdisciplinary, international environment and a supportive team atmosphere. Benefits include flexible working models, professional development in new lab techniques, and comprehensive social benefits typical of the German public service sector (TV-L).
